📖 Overview

Mesopelagic species, showing marked stratification of size with depth, with the largest individuals deepest ; also bathypelagic . Exhibits diel color change, darkening slightly at night . Feeds on zooplankton.

🐟 Physical Description

Dorsal spines (total): 0; Dorsal soft rays (total): 16 - 20; Anal spines: 0; Anal soft rays: 28 - 31. Silvery operculum and peritoneum; tail translucent ventrally; dorsal and caudal rays pigmented . Single row of body photophores .: elongated.
